Look at the Northshore pic and the NOLA pic. The “wire” you see connects the two. The body of water is not the gulf but Lake Ponchartrain. The “wire” is the causeway- aka “the longest bridge in the world” (at one time).

They gave it its own category. It's still the longest bridge "continuously over water" in the world.
The others that are longer have sections where it has landings on islands or other land masses.
